Al Di Meola, a living guitar legend and member of the Guitar Player Magazine Gallery of Greats, stands among the most influential guitarists of our time. Renowned for his intricate rhythmic syncopation, lyrical melodies, and sophisticated harmonies, he has built a celebrated four-decade career marked by four gold and two platinum albums, over six million records sold worldwide, and numerous honors. His accolades include an Honorary Doctorate from Berklee College of Music, the Montreal Jazz Festival's Honorary Miles Davis Award, the BBC Lifetime Achievement Award presented by Sir George Martin, and five German gold albums. With 12 Guitar Player Magazine awards and multiple Grammy nominations, Di Meola's artistry continues to inspire generations of musicians. Part of the TD Bank Jazz Series
